Hi all,
Since updating to version 2015.2.4. some of the image creation/reading function that use
to work are throwing errors on my machine.
Specifically, running the following minimal code that creates an OpenCL Image from an
array and reads it back:
#--------------code
from __future__ import print_function
import numpy as np
import pyopencl as cl
ctx = cl.create_some_context(interactive=False)
queue = cl.CommandQueue(ctx)
data = np.random.randn(100,100).astype(np.float32)
im = cl.image_from_array(ctx, np.asarray(data))
out = np.empty_like(data)
cl.enqueue_copy(queue,out,im, origin = (0,0), region = (100,100))
print(np.allclose(data,out))
#--------------/code
results in the following error*
pyopencl.cffi_cl.RuntimeError: clcreateimage failed: IMAGE_FORMAT_NOT_SUPPORTED
The same code runs just fine with version 2015.1.
Can anybody else confirm that issue and are there any thoughts where that error might
originate from?
Can (partly) confirm this on os x 10.11.4, if I choose the CPU as device. This device does
not support the ImageFormat(R, FLOAT), which gets selected to match the array type. Call
cl.get_supported_image_formats(ctx, cl.mem_flags.READ_ONLY, cl.mem_object_type.IMAGE2D)
to see the supported image formats.

Note, only images with 4 channels are guaranteed to be supported on all systems, so it was
just by luck that you had success with your code snippet in previous versions.
